Martin Kirketerp
Danish sailor
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Martin Kirketerp Ibsen (born 13 July 1982) is a Danish sailor in the 49er class who sails with Jonas Warrer.[1] At the 2008 Summer Olympics, they stood to win the gold medal before the final round, but their mast broke shortly before start.[2] The Croatian team lent the Danes their boat, and the Danes went on to finish seventh in the round, which would win them the gold medal.[3]

He joined Team Sanaya[4][circular reference] as a replacement crew member for legs 5 and 7 of the 2011–12 Volvo Ocean Race.[5][6]
